Critical Evaluation
The conference is a masterclass in scientific communication, delivered by one of the world’s leading astrophysicists. Françoise Combes combines historical narrative with cutting-edge research, making complex topics accessible without oversimplifying. The talk is well-structured, starting with the early 20th-century debate about the nature of nebulae, which sets the stage for the discovery of galaxies. She highlights the crucial role of Henrietta Leavitt, whose work on Cepheid variables enabled distance measurements, and she does not shy away from discussing the gender biases that hindered women in science, adding a valuable social dimension. The scientific content is accurate and up-to-date, covering the Big Bang, cosmic expansion, dark matter, and dark energy. Combes explains the accelerating expansion and the mystery of dark energy, which constitutes about 68% of the universe. She also discusses the formation of galaxies and large-scale structures, referencing simulations and observations. The talk is enhanced by visuals, including images from the James Webb Space Telescope, which are at the forefront of current research. The speaker’s authority is unquestionable, given her position as president of the French Academy of Sciences and her extensive research contributions. The only minor critique is that the talk is quite dense, and some concepts might require prior knowledge, but this is not a flaw given the audience. The title accurately reflects the content, and the talk successfully fulfills its promise. Overall, this is an excellent presentation that is both informative and inspiring.

Key Moments
Markers derived by PSI from the transcript: the creator did not define chapters.
- Introduction by the host, presenting Françoise Combes and her achievements.
- Combes begins her talk, introducing the topic and the historical context.
- Discussion of the 1920 debate between Shapley and Curtis about the nature of nebulae.
- Explanation of Henrietta Leavitt's discovery of the period-luminosity relation for Cepheid variables.
- Use of Cepheid variables to measure distances to galaxies, establishing that they are separate systems.
- Hubble's law and the discovery of the expansion of the universe.
- The Big Bang theory and the cosmic microwave background.
- Formation of galaxies and large-scale structures, including the role of dark matter.
- Dark energy and the accelerating expansion of the universe.
- Recent observations from the James Webb Space Telescope and the study of primordial galaxies.
